While addressing the National Guard Association in Detroit, Trump pledged to initiate a Space National Guard before pledging an unprecedented new layer of national defense.

The former president later pledged to build an antimissile system similar to Israel’s Iron Dome air defense system, which is capable of intercepting short-range rockets in the air above the state.

“And we’re going to build a great Iron Dome for missile defense around our nation. Other countries have said Israel has it. You know, [former President] Ronald Reagan wanted this many years ago, but we didn’t have the technology at that point. But now we have the technology,” Trump said.

Trump has repeatedly vowed to create an Iron Dome-style system, stating on the campaign trail over the past year he would work to build “the greatest dome of them all” due to “a lot of hostile people out there.” — The Hill
